How to add custom fields to a Square Online Basket
I am creating a Gift Card for a Photographic service. I have the item set up and ready to purchase, but I need to add two more fields that capture the recipients name and email address. I have added these fields under "profiles" in the Customer section, but they do not show up in my basket. How do I associated them with the specific product please?

I have a couple of suggestions here;
When customers check out from your Square Online site, they can leave you additional notes regarding their orders. To enable this feature:
- From your Square Online Overview page, go to Settings > Checkout or Shared Settings > Checkout.
- Select Edit customer inputs.
- Under ‘Checkout fields’, tick the Allow customer to leave a note to seller option.
- Select Save when finished.
Learn more about your checkout options here - it's important to note that this isn't a mandatory field which may run the risk of customers leaving the field blank.
Another option, depending on your website display/sales work would be to add a modifier text box to each item that requires customers to input their details and make it a required field.
This box will appear on the item page itself - here's an example I did where engraving was required:
You can make the contact details a required field here but the details will only be visible to you.

So yes, with any order, customers will be required to input that data and then you'll be able to view it in your Orders Dashboard.
Those order details (contact info) will remain there even after the order has been completed.
